Wet Vacuum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No Easy to clean up yourself
Large water spill (over 10 gallons) No Yes Too much water for DIY cleanup
Water damage in a confined space (e.g. Crawl space) No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Water damage with electrical issues No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Water damage with mold or mildew No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Water damage with structural issues No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ise

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Cost In Delray Beach, FL

The cost of wet vacuum water extraction in Delray Beach, FL can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Prices start at around $500 for small water spills, but can range up to $2,500 or more for larger jobs.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action for your specific situation and provide a free estimate for our services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small water spill cleanup $500 – $1,000 Size of spill, location, and equipment needed
Large water spill cleanup $1,000 – $2,500 Size of spill, location, and equipment needed
Water damage restoration $1,500 – $3,500 Size of damage, location, and equipment needed
Dehumidification and drying $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of service
Moisture testing and inspection $200 – $500 Size of affected area and complexity of job
Wet vacuum equipment rental $100 – $300 Duration of rental and equipment needed
